Convert Glb To Vrm
Converting a GLB file to a VRM avatar is a systematic process of adding structure and metadata to a standard 3D model. While it requires attention to detail, it is a rewarding skill for anyone looking to enter the world of VR and digital avatars.
Before exporting, ensure your character is in a "T-Pose." If they are in an "A-Pose," the arm animations will look broken in most software.
Method 1: The Standard Way (Using Blender and the VRM Addon)
: The GLB must have a standard humanoid rig (hips, spine, neck, head, and limbs). convert glb to vrm
Incorrect initial scale values or non-normalized transformations on the GLB container.
Click to verify that Unity has correctly assigned the head, spine, arms, and legs. Fix any misaligned bones, then click Done . Step 3: Generate the VRM Components
Best for: High-end production, testing shaders, and complex physics. Converting a GLB file to a VRM avatar
You will now see components like VRM Blend Shape Proxy and VRM Look At Head attached to the object. Fine-tune your expressions, eye-tracking limits, and spring bone colliders here.
: Download and install the VRM Add-on for Blender. Import GLB : Go to File > Import > glTF 2.0 (.glb) . Map Humanoid Bones : Select your armature.
:
Rules for how the avatar’s eyes track a camera or look around naturally.
Open Unity Hub and create a new 3D project (Unity 2021 LTS or 2022 LTS versions are highly recommended).